Science Discovery For Secondary 2 / 8th Grade text book
5 units / 15 chapters on:
Science as an inquiry
Solving problems in science
Models and systems
The particulate model of matter
Atoms, molecules and ions
Digestion
Transport in living things
Sexual reproduction in human beings
Issues on sex
Energy
Light and colour
Introducing electricity
Household electricity
Interactions
Changing matter
Sound
Living things in an ecosystem
Energy transfer in ecosystems
Cycles
Nutrient cycles in the ecosystem
271 pages
Science Discovery For Secondary 2 / 8th Grade theory work book
5 units / 15 chapters
60 exercises
151 pages
Science Discovery For Secondary 2 / 8th Grade practical work book
5 units / 15 chapters
47 well-designed experiments structured as follows:
Aims
Apparatus and materials
Skills
Procedure and observations
126 pages
